生成式AI(Generative AI)近年来取得了显著的进展,成为人工智能领域的重要分支。它通过学习数据的分布特性,生成与训练数据具有相似特征的新内容。生成式AI的应用场景广泛,包括自然语言处理、计算机视觉、音频生成等领域。本文将深入探讨生成式AI模型的技术实现细节,并分享高效的算法优化方法,帮助企业更好地理解和应用生成式AI技术。
一、生成式AI模型的技术实现
生成式AI的核心在于通过模型生成新的数据样本。目前主流的生成式AI模型主要包括以下几种:
1.1 基础概念与原理
生成式AI的核心思想是通过学习数据的分布特性,生成与训练数据具有相似特征的新内容。其主要实现方式包括:
- 生成对抗网络(GANs):由生成器和判别器两个神经网络组成,通过对抗训练生成逼真的数据样本。
- 变分自编码器(VAEs):通过编码器将数据映射到潜在空间,解码器再将潜在空间的数据映射回原始数据空间。
- Transformer模型:基于自注意力机制,广泛应用于自然语言处理领域的生成任务。
1.2 核心技术与挑战
生成式AI的实现涉及多个关键技术,同时也面临诸多挑战:
- 数据分布建模:生成式AI需要准确建模数据的分布特性,尤其是在高维数据空间中。
- 训练稳定性:生成器和判别器的训练需要保持平衡,避免生成器或判别器主导训练过程。
- 模式坍缩:生成器可能无法生成多样化的样本,导致生成结果单一。
1.3 模型架构与训练过程
以GANs为例,其模型架构和训练过程如下:
- 生成器:通过多层感知机(MLP)或卷积神经网络(CNN)生成逼真的数据样本。
- 判别器:通过MLP或CNN判断输入数据是真实数据还是生成数据。
- 对抗训练:通过最小化判别器的损失函数和最大化生成器的损失函数,实现生成器和判别器的交替优化。
二、生成式AI模型的高效算法优化方法
为了提高生成式AI模型的性能和效率,需要采用高效的算法优化方法。以下是一些关键优化策略:
2.1 优化目标与评估指标
在优化生成式AI模型时,需要明确优化目标和评估指标:
- 优化目标:提高生成样本的质量、多样性和真实性。
- 评估指标:包括生成样本的相似性(如FID、IS等)、生成过程的效率(如训练时间、生成速度)等。
2.2 常见优化算法
以下是一些常用的优化算法:
- Adam优化器:通过自适应学习率调整,提高训练效率。
- 梯度剪裁:防止梯度爆炸,保持模型权重的稳定更新。
- 标签平滑:通过平滑真实标签和生成标签,提高模型的泛化能力。
2.3 超参数调优
生成式AI模型的性能对超参数敏感,需要进行细致的调优:
- 学习率:选择合适的学习率,避免训练过程中的震荡或收敛过慢。
- 批量大小:调整批量大小,平衡训练效率和模型稳定性。
- 正则化参数:通过L2正则化等方法,防止模型过拟合。
2.4 分布式训练与并行计算
为了提高生成式AI模型的训练效率,可以采用分布式训练和并行计算:
- 数据并行:将数据分片到多个GPU上,加速训练过程。
- 模型并行:将模型分片到多个GPU上,减少单个GPU的计算负担。
2.5 模型压缩与加速
在生成式AI模型的实际应用中,模型压缩与加速技术尤为重要:
- 剪枝:通过移除冗余的神经网络权重,减少模型的计算量。
- 量化:通过降低模型参数的精度,减少模型的存储和计算需求。
三、生成式AI在企业中的应用
生成式AI技术在企业中的应用前景广阔,特别是在数据中台、数字孪生和数字可视化等领域。
3.1 数据中台
生成式AI可以用于数据中台的智能化建设,例如:
- 数据生成:通过生成式AI生成高质量的训练数据,提升数据中台的效率。
- 数据增强:通过生成式AI对数据进行增强,提升数据中台的多样性。
3.2 数字孪生
生成式AI在数字孪生中的应用包括:
- 虚拟场景生成:通过生成式AI生成逼真的虚拟场景,提升数字孪生的沉浸式体验。
- 实时数据模拟:通过生成式AI模拟实时数据,提升数字孪生的动态性。
3.3 数字可视化
生成式AI在数字可视化中的应用包括:
- 可视化内容生成:通过生成式AI生成丰富的可视化内容,提升数字可视化的表现力。
- 交互式可视化:通过生成式AI实现交互式可视化,提升用户的参与感。
四、未来发展趋势与挑战
生成式AI技术的发展前景广阔,但也面临诸多挑战:
4.1 未来发展趋势
- 多模态生成:生成式AI将向多模态方向发展,实现跨模态数据的协同生成。
- 实时生成:生成式AI将向实时生成方向发展,满足实时应用的需求。
- 可解释性增强:生成式AI的可解释性将得到进一步提升,满足企业对模型透明度的需求。
4.2 挑战与解决方案
- 计算资源需求:生成式AI模型的训练和推理需要大量的计算资源,可以通过分布式计算和模型压缩技术加以解决。
- 数据隐私问题:生成式AI模型的训练需要大量的数据,如何保护数据隐私是一个重要挑战,可以通过数据脱敏和联邦学习等技术加以解决。
五、结语
生成式AI技术的快速发展为企业提供了新的机遇和挑战。通过深入了解生成式AI模型的技术实现和高效算法优化方法,企业可以更好地应用生成式AI技术,提升数据中台、数字孪生和数字可视化等领域的智能化水平。
如果您对生成式AI技术感兴趣,可以申请试用相关工具,了解更多具体信息:申请试用。
申请试用&下载资料
点击袋鼠云官网申请免费试用:
https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:
https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:
https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:
https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:
https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:
https://www.dtstack.com/resources/1004/?src=bbs
免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。